Typical Repertoire and Concert Programming

Maria João Pires is known for a core repertoire that centers on Classical and Romantic piano literature, especially Mozart, Beethoven, Schubert, Schumann, Chopin, and Brahms. Her programs often pair a major sonata with shorter character pieces or songs, balancing lyrical introspection with formal clarity. Contemporary works and less familiar composers sometimes appear, reflecting her openness to new music without abandoning canonical anchors.

Concert organizers typically structure programs to suit venue acoustics and audience expectations. Solo recitals may highlight thematic coherence or stylistic contrast, while orchestral appearances emphasize concerto repertoire. This repertoire flexibility helps explain why two references to "Maria João Pires concerts" can differ yet remain accurate descriptions of her work.

Signature Works and Frequently Programmed Composers

  • Mozart piano concertos and sonatas
  • Beethoven sonatas and variations
  • Schubert impromptus and late sonatas
  • Chopin nocturnes, ballades, and scherzos
  • Brahms intermezzos and Paganini Variations
  • Selected works by Debussy and Ravel

Notable Venues and Festival Appearances

Over decades, Maria João Pires has appeared at major concert halls and festivals worldwide, establishing a profile familiar to European and international audiences. These venues shape how her concerts are remembered and documented. While specific 2019 appearances may be retrievable through festival archives, the following locations represent recurring hosts across her career. Understanding this landscape helps interpret current queries within a long-term pattern rather than isolated events.

Attribute Verified Detail Source Type
Primary Geographic Focus Europe, with regular appearances in Belgium, France, Germany, Portugal, United Kingdom Concert programs and festival archives
Major Halls Concertgebouw (Amsterdam), Wigmore Hall (London), Théâtre des Champs-Élysées (Paris), Gewandhaus (Leipzig) Venue archives
Notable Festivals Proms (BBC), Festival de Radio France et Montpellier, Schleswig-Holstein Musik Festival Festival brochures and schedules
Orchestra Collaborations Berlin Philharmonic, London Symphony Orchestra, Orchestre National de France Orchestra archives and reviews
